Arformoterol, sold under the brand name Brovana among others, is a medication used for the treatment of chronic obstructive pulmonary disease (COPD).[1][2]

It is a long-acting β2 adrenoreceptor agonist (LABA) and it is the active (R,R)-(−)-enantiomer of formoterol.[1] It was approved for medical use in the United States in October 2006.[1] It is available as a generic medication.[3]

Medical uses[edit]

Arformoterol is indicated for the maintenance treatment of bronchoconstriction in people with chronic obstructive pulmonary disease (COPD).[1]
